Abandoned Cat Finds New Hope After Owner's Move
A cat has captured the attention of internet users after being abandoned by its owner during a move. The story was shared on Reddit by a user who reported that their uncle left the cat behind when relocating to a new home. The user took the cat in, noting that it appeared sad following the abandonment.
According to Cats Protection, a U.K. charity, moving can be particularly stressful for cats as they thrive on routine and familiarity. The organization recommends creating a safe space in both the old and new homes for pets, providing clean water and litter trays, and allowing cats to acclimate gradually rather than forcing them into unfamiliar environments immediately.
The Reddit post garnered significant support from other users, many expressing sympathy for the abandoned cat and praise for its new caretaker. Comments highlighted that while the cat may be mourning its previous owner, it is likely to adjust positively over time with love and care in its new environment.
The situation underscores concerns about pet abandonment during relocations and emphasizes responsible pet ownership practices when moving households.

To add real value that was missing from this article: individuals planning a move with pets should start preparing well in advance by researching local animal services that can assist with relocation needs. They should also consider visiting potential new homes beforehand with their pets if possible so they can explore and become familiar with their new environment gradually before making the full transition. Additionally, keeping consistent routines around feeding times and play can help ease anxiety during changes. Finally, connecting with local animal shelters or community groups focused on responsible pet ownership can provide ongoing resources and support throughout any moving process.
